THAIVISA 2019 CALENDAR and NOVEMBER 2018 PHOTO COMPETITION

 

Continuing the great work in previous years, it's that time of the year for starting the design of the 2019 / 2562 Thaivisa Calendar.

Previous calendars, 2010 - 2018 were a great success due to the excellent photo contributions from the Thaivisa Members.

All members are welcome to submit their images for them to be considered for inclusion in the 2019 Thaivisa Calendar.

Submissions close at 5 pm on Friday November 30th 2018.

Please read the instructions below this image for requirements regarding sizing etc.

These are very important for the calendar quality as it will be printable

NOTE - This topic will also incorporate the November competition with the winning entry awarded the ฿1000 Phone Voucher.25471042015_22e4c91c1a_k.jpg

 

Requirements:

  • Photo must have been taken within Thailand and must have been taken by the member posting the photo.
  • Landscape mode (wide). Portrait mode (tall) is possible if it can be cropped properly to fit the calendar's format. Also, portrait mode if you think it will make a suitable cover page. No panoramas please.
  • Minimum 1200 pixels wide, preferably 2048 as the calendar will be printable and need the resolutions to be high for good print quality. Link to higher resolution image if possible.
  • Important Note: Due to attached files auto-sized to only 800 wide, please supply a link to the image on a photo-sharing site such as Flickr.com or cloud storage such as Dropbox, not limited to just these two though.
  • Please use your best photos that you feel would fit and be appropriate for a published calendar.
  • By posting your images here you give Thaivisa permission to use them in the Calendar. Credit will be given through watermarks on the photos unless a member specifically wishes it not to be.
  •  Please do not use personal watermark on your images

 

 

Additional:

  • If possible but not a requirement, please post the location and possible information about the photo. Many members were interested in that information and were asking about it.
  • Please, only 1 photo per post as it makes it very difficult to manage during the decision process. Try and limit to no more than 2-3 contributions.


This topic will be open until Friday November 30 2018 and the photos presented to the mod/Admin team for initial cuts in selecting the photos. If there are insufficient photos that are considered suitable for the calendar, either previous contributions will be recycled or free use photos from the Internet will be used.

 

Looking forward to seeing this year's' contributions.

 

Note: - If you see a photo(s) that you really like please use the Like button for the poster. It will help with the decision process.
